The Compagnie Meusienne de Chemins de Fer, known colloquially as Le Meusien, operated a 203 kilometer metre gauge rail network in the French departement of Meuse from 1888 to 1922. Its most westerly branch had been built by the Compagnie des Chemins de Fer d'Interet Local de la Meuse and commissioned section by section from 1878. The Societe Generale des Chemins de Fer Economiques took over the network in 1922 and ran it until its decline and closure between 1929 and 1938.
